On Oct 05, 2001 07:46 -0400, Jason A. Lixfeld wrote:
> I'm just looking for clarification:
>
> ext2resize will actually resize ext3 aswell? With no extra flags? It
> will just know that the LVM is ext3 and not ext2?
If it is unmounted, it will work fine. There is no difference between
ext2 and ext3 for a (cleanly) unmounted filesystem (the journal is just
a regular file). If you try to resize a filesystem that has a dirty
journal (e.g. after a crash) it will refuse to do so and you need to
run e2fsck.
